WARNING: Always stop the engine, dis- connect spark plug wire and move it away from the spark plug before performing any adjustments or repairs.

Never attempt to clean the chute or make any adjustments while the engine is running.

Adjustments

Traction Drive Control

Refer to the Final Adjustment section of the Set-Up Instructions to adjust the traction drive control. If you are not sure of proper adjustment, check as follows.

Drain the gasoline or place plastic film under the gas cap if the snow thrower has already been operated.

Tip the snow thrower forward and remove the four self-tapping screws that hold the frame cover underneath the snow thrower.

With the traction drive control released, make sure that there is clearance between the friction wheel and the friction plate in all positions of the shift lever. See Figure 22.

NOTE: If you placed plastic under the gas cap, be certain to remove it.

Augers

The augers are secured to the spiral shaft with two shear bolts and hex lock nuts. If you hit a foreign object or ice jam, the snow thrower is designed so that the bolts will shear.

If the augers will not turn, check to see if the bolts have sheared. Replace if necessary. See Figure 23. Two replacement shear bolts and hex lock nuts have been provided in Group D of the hardware pack which is illustrated on page 5.

With the traction drive control engaged, make sure that the friction wheel is making contact with the friction plate. Also make sure that the overtravel spring is stretched.

If adjustment is necessary, loosen the jam nut on the traction drive cable and thread the cable in or out as necessary.

Tighten the jam nut to secure the cable when correct adjustment is reached. Reassemble the frame cover.

Shift Rod

To adjust the shift rod, proceed as follows.

Remove the hairpin clip and flat washer from the ferrule underneath the shift panel. Remove the ferrule from the hole in the shift lever.

Place the shift lever on the handle panel in the sixth (6) speed position (all the way forward).

Push down on the shift rod (and shift arm assembly) as far as it will go. Hold it in this position. See Figure 24.

Thread the ferrule up or down the shift rod as necessary until the ferrule lines up with the upper hole in the shift lever.
